Episode Synopsis "8: Islamic Political Thought, Sinners, Innovators, and the Companions (Points 14-17)"
Moosaa Richardson explains Points 14-17 of the classic text, Sharhus-Sunnah (The Creed Explained) of al-Imaam Ismaa'eel ibn Yahyaa al-Muzani [d.264], on topics of politics in Islam, the Muslims' stance on sinners and innovators, as well as the issue of the Companions.Get the workbook in print or kindle, and other very helpful resources to follow along in this class by visiting the following page on Bakkah.net: http://www.bakkah.net/en/free-islamic-courses-online-recordings-workbooks-resources.htmThis class was originally recorded at Masjid al-Furqaan in Toronto, Ontario (Canada) on 1438.11.05.
